About Taverna
Taverna is a Mediterranean and International restaurant in Ciudad de Mexico. Rated 4.7/5 based on 709 reviews on OpenTable. Casual Elegant.

This was a find as we were walking by about 3pm after visiting the biblioteque and market. It literally is a hole in the wall doorway to a house from 1908 that has been beautifuuly restored keeping it's rustic appearance. It's on several levels and lit by candles and beautiful incandescent amber lights. The food style is Mediterranean-inspired with unique dishes not found elsewhere. Seating is spread across various rooms with small and larger tables should you come with a group. Many dishes are served family style, so be sure to ask which ones those are. You'll enjoy your experience here whether on a date or with a group. Our spend between the two of us was 1200 MX, note we only had bottled water, split the short rib sandwich and donor the carrot dish and cucumber salad. We topped it off with a coffee and their version of lemon pie. Our waiter was Katerina and she was delightful and attentive.

We came with a rowdy group of eight who only spoke English, which can sometimes make it difficult for staff to feel comfortable showcasing their passions and their establishment in a different language. This place clearly understands that hospitality is about the guests, and they accommodated us accordingly. In particular, Esteban answered all our questions, and when he didn’t know something, he took the time to find out. I don’t like feeling as though I’m inconveniencing a server, and Esteban’s presence felt like he was naturally part of our party—always attentive but never imposing. They put a lot of care into their dishes. There were little touches I really appreciated, like the chepiche on the fish appetizer. It was cool to taste the local flavors of Oaxaca. They also served duck with an apple–anise sauce that had a surprisingly creamy, almost lactic quality. And the dates are as good as it gets if you enjoy a sweet-and-savory treat. We also split an entire fish that was served with an orange onion spiced salad/sauce that was very enjoyable and for me a very unique presentation. Highly recommend.
